Abstract
In 2002, the peer review for the somatic indications of medical rehabilitation was further developed. This process was aimed at adjusting the peer review checklist to the "Guide for the Uniform Medical Report of the Statutory German Pension Insurance Scheme" ("Leitfaden zum einheitlichen Entlassungsbericht der Rentenversicherung"), at harmonising the peer review with the version used in the quality assurance programme of the German health insurance and at reducing requirements by focusing on criteria relevant in the individual case. This paper reports on the consensus process carried out and outlines the modifications of the peer review procedure.
